ورود

View Full Version : سوال: ذخیره نشدن یوزر و پسورد در هر بار لاگین



maJJJid
شنبه 20 مهر 1392, 15:34 عصر
سلام خدمت همه دوستان.
من میخام هر بار که کاربر میاد تو صفحه لاگین یوزر و پسورد قبلی در TextBox ها نباشه و TextBox ها خالی باشه.من اومدم EnableViewState مربوط به TextBox ها رو False کردم.از کنترل Login ویژوال استودیو استفاده کردم که EnableViewState مربوط به کنترل Login رو هم False کردم. و توی رویداد Page Load این کد هارو نوشتم :


if (Request.Cookies["UserSettings"] != null)
{
HttpCookie myCookie = new HttpCookie("UserSettings");
myCookie.Expires = DateTime.Now.AddDays(-1d);
Response.Cookies.Add(myCookie);
}

ولی باز هم وقتی کاربر میاد تو صفحه لاگین , یوزر و پسورد قبلی توی TextBox ها هست.ولی من میخام که هر وقت کاربر میاد تو صفحه لاگین TextBox های Username و Password خالی باشه و کاربر مجبور باشه هر بار برای ورود به سایت یوزر و پسورد اش رو تایپ کنه.
حالا چیکار کنم ؟

sasanrstm
دوشنبه 22 مهر 1392, 02:19 صبح
سلام اولن اگه تکست پسورد تو رو اگه از نوع پسورد انتخاب کنی که پسورد به هیچ وجه نشون داده نمیشه یوزرت هم فکر نکنم زیاد خطری باشه چون تا کسی این دوتا رو باهم وارد نکنه که نمی تونه لاگین بشه واسه پاک کردن تکست هات هم هم تو پیج لود وهم بعد از عمل اینزرت میتونی خالیشون کنی .ودر اخر اول جستجو کن بعد تایپک بزن مطالب زیادی در این مورد تو همین سایت هست. موفق باشی. به جمع برنامه نویسان بیکار خوش آمدی.

sendelbor
دوشنبه 22 مهر 1392, 07:12 صبح
autocomplete تکست باکست رو off کن

sasanrstm
دوشنبه 22 مهر 1392, 07:45 صبح
autocomplete تکست باکست رو off کن
ببخشید این گزینه که فرمودین کجا قرارداره من هرچی گشتم کلمه off رو پیدا نکردم میشه با تصویر بگی مرسی.

sendelbor
دوشنبه 22 مهر 1392, 07:56 صبح
من الان ویژوال استدیو دم دستم نیست
توی پروپرتی های اون تکست باکس بگرد من رندر شدش رو گفتم. یعنی برا المان های اچ تی ام ال برای سرور ساید ها off نیست disable میشه


<asp:TextBox ID="txt" runat="server" autocomplete="off" />

sara.64
شنبه 26 بهمن 1392, 09:07 صبح
چرا پست امکان حذف نداره؟!!